How Do Plants Have Low Energy Needs . Plants do not need to move from one place to another. Plants use photosynthesis to make sugar. They produce oxygen during this process. In plants, the movements are usually at the cellular level and hence a far less amount of energy is required by plants. When energy supplies are low, plants can reduce energy usage by slowing down their metabolic activities. But sometimes they absorb more energy than they can use, and that excess can damage critical proteins. To protect themselves, they convert the excess energy into heat and send it back out.
